main set
1. Oceans
2. Can't keep
3. Low light
4. Corduroy
5. Breakerfall
6. Mind your manners
7. Why go
8. Gods dice
9. Lightning bolt
10. In hiding
11. Evenflow
12. Setting forth
13. Not for you
14. Daughter/It's OK
15. Infallible
16. After hours
17. Sirens
18. Jeremy
19. Gonna See My Friend
20. Porch

encore 1
21. Soon Forget
22. Yellow Moon
23. Thumbing My Way
24. Footsteps
25. Mother
26. Insignificance
27. Given To Fly
28. Got Some
29. Betterman

encore 2
30. Go
31. DTE
32. Black
33. Alive
34. Kick Out The Jams
35. Yellow Ledbetter
